ZIP code 58266 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Niagara, Grand Forks County, North Dakota, home to just 203 residents across 290.0 square miles, a density of 1 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.
ZIP 58266 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$88,889 (8% above the North Dakota average), while per-capita income is $41,505. Poverty here runs at 0.0%, with unemployment measured at 0.0%. Median home value sits at -, median rent at - a month, and owner-occupancy at 78.9%.
Formal educational attainment runs low here: just 10.4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 60, and the average commute is -.
